To update the firmware on your ZTE MF286D, you can use the built-in web management interface for automatic updates or flash custom firmware like OpenWrt if you are looking for advanced features. Official Firmware Update Procedure

Most ZTE MF286D units (especially those provided by carriers like Three) are designed to update automatically, but you can manually check for versions using these steps according to guides from HardReset.info:

Log In: Connect a device to your router via Wi-Fi or Ethernet. Open a web browser and enter the router's IP address (usually 192.168.1.1 or 192.168.0.1). Use the default credentials (often admin for both, or check the label on the bottom of the device).

Navigate to Settings: Go to Advanced Settings (or just Settings) > Device Settings. Update Management: Select the Update Management tab. Check for Updates:

You can toggle Auto-check New Version to allow the router to update itself periodically.

To check immediately, click the Check button under the "Check New Version" section. zte mf286d firmware update

Install: If an update is found, follow the on-screen prompts to download and install. Do not power off the router during this process, as it can cause a permanent failure (brick) [6]. Advanced: Custom Firmware (OpenWrt)

If you want more control over your hardware (like advanced DDNS or VPN support), the ZTE MF286D is well-supported by the OpenWrt Wiki.

Firmware Selection: You can find stable or nightly builds using the OpenWrt Firmware Selector.

Caution: Flashing custom firmware is an advanced process that involves SSH access and command-line tools. It generally voids your warranty and carries a risk of bricking the device if done incorrectly. Troubleshooting Tips

Factory Reset: If the update fails or the interface is unresponsive, you can hold the physical Reset button on the device for about 15 seconds to return it to factory defaults [3].

Carrier Locks: If your router was provided by a specific network provider, they may "push" updates on their own schedule, and manual checks might not always reveal the latest generic ZTE firmware [3].

To update the firmware on your ZTE MF286D router, you can use the built-in online update tool or perform a manual "offline" update if you have the firmware file from the ZTE Support site. Method 1: Automatic Online Update

This is the safest and easiest way to ensure you have the latest software version directly from ZTE's servers.

Log In: Enter the Website Password found on the sticker located under your device.

Navigate to Updates: Go to Settings > Device Settings > Update Management. Check for Updates: Click the Check button in the "Check New Version" section.

If a new version is found, follow the on-screen prompts to download and install it.

Wait for Completion: Do not power off the router while the update is in progress. The device will reboot automatically once finished. Method 2: Manual (Offline) Update

If you have downloaded a specific firmware package (e.g., from the ZTE official website), use these steps:

Preparation: Download the correct firmware for your specific country/region to your computer.

Upload Firmware: In the same Update Management menu used in Method 1, look for an Offline Update or Local Upgrade option.

Select File: Click Browse, select the .bin or .zip firmware file you downloaded, and click Apply or Update.

Install: The router will verify the file and begin the installation. Method 3: For Advanced Users (OpenWrt) from the ZTE official website )

If you are looking to install custom firmware like OpenWrt for more control:

You can find the latest stable builds and installation instructions on the OpenWrt ZTE MF286D Wiki.
